&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;A &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;fitness landscape&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; is a conceptual and mathematical model in [[Evolutionary Biology]] representing the relationship between genotypes (or phenotypes) and reproductive fitness. Introduced by Sewall Wright in 1932, it maps populations as points moving across a surface where altitude represents fitness: peaks are local optima, valleys are low-fitness combinations, and ridges connect one peak to another.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The metaphor is seductive and misleading in roughly equal measure. Landscapes are static objects; evolution moves through a landscape that is itself moving, because fitness is always relative to an environment that includes other evolving organisms. A peak today is a valley tomorrow. The landscape metaphor obscures the fact that [[Evolvability|evolvability]] is a property of the mapping between genetic and phenotypic space, not a property of any fixed surface. It also silently assumes that fitness is a real-valued function on genotype space — an assumption that fails whenever the fitness of a genotype depends on its frequency in the population, as in [[Frequency-Dependent Selection]].&lt;br /&gt;

The practical use of fitness landscapes in [[Protein Engineering]] and [[Directed Evolution]] has been substantial. The theoretical use in evolutionary biology has been substantial and confused.&lt;br /&gt;
